Gandiva — Interceptor quadcopter · swarm-capable

Gandiva

Interceptor quadcopter · swarm-capable

Gandiva is a counter-drone system in two parts: a detection layer that uses multi-sensor fusion to spot and track a hostile UAV, and an interceptor layer that deploys drones to bring it down — the whole engagement run from a single Ground Control Unit. Each interceptor is a carbon-fibre 450-class quadcopter, stabilised by an ArduPilot autopilot and fitted with a kinetic tip. It dashes at 90–126 km/h, and 2–10+ can fly together for a layered, sensor-cued intercept.

Swarm — Autonomous master–slave swarm · distributed intelligence

Swarm

Autonomous master–slave swarm · distributed intelligence

Swarm is a coordinated team of drones: one 'master' leading any number of others, all built on the 5-inch Zeus quadcopter. They fly as a single formation, covering more ground than a lone UAV while the mission carries on even if a drone drops out. If the master is lost or neutralised, another drone automatically takes over the lead and the rest fall in behind it — so there's no single point of failure. The swarm's intelligence runs onboard each aircraft, coordinating the formation over a long-range radio link, with every drone on a proven ArduPilot autopilot for stable, GPS-guided flight. Automatic return-to-launch and auto-land failsafes bring the drones home safely, and the whole swarm is flown and monitored from a single ground station for tactical, surveillance and autonomy research.

Indrajit — Fibre-optic FPV · EW-resilient

Indrajit

Fibre-optic FPV · EW-resilient

10-inch FPV quadcopter with fibre-optic tether for electronic-warfare-resistant command and video. Four range configurations (2 / 5 / 10 / 20 km), 90–100 km/h cruise, analog or digital HD video options. The GCU converts digital signals to optical for jam-proof terminal control.

Nayanavat — Fuel-engine target drone · adversary-simulation trainer

Nayanavat

Fuel-engine target drone · adversary-simulation trainer

Two-stroke fuel-engine target drone on a balsa-and-plywood airframe, configurable with OS 0.46 / 0.56 or DA / DLE 35 engines. Built for air-defence unit training and gunnery practice. Simulates hostile-aircraft flight characteristics and radar signatures more safely and economically than manned targets.

Phoenix — Balsa fixed-wing FPV · low-cost, expendable

Phoenix

Balsa fixed-wing FPV · low-cost, expendable

A low-cost fixed-wing built from balsa and plywood and flown line-of-sight through FPV goggles. Battery-electric, shipped as an ARF kit, roughly 3 kg all-up with a 1 kg payload bay and 10–15 minutes on a charge out to 5–6 km. No autopilot suite: manual stabilisation and a clean video feed to the pilot. The wooden airframe keeps unit cost low enough to fly it as an entry-level trainer or treat it as expendable on short-range tactical tasks.

Zeus — Hybrid-frame FPV trainer · ArduPilot safety net

Zeus

Hybrid-frame FPV trainer · ArduPilot safety net

Hybrid carbon-fibre and fibreglass FPV platform that bridges high-speed racing and stabilised camera drones. The rigid CF core keeps manoeuvres precise while impact-resistant fibreglass arms and reinforced motor mounts absorb the hard landings of the training phase. An ArduPilot flight controller gives new pilots a safety net: auto-level Stabilize, GPS Loiter, and one-switch Return-to-Launch with signal-loss and low-battery failsafe. Live telemetry (voltage, GPS, altitude, speed) streams straight into the pilot's goggles.
